Coffee Ceremony: Aromatic Start, you know?
The very coffee bit typically starts early. What they normally do is whisk you off to a local village, somewhere you can watch the traditional preparation of Zanzibar coffee. This typically includes roasting the beans over an open fire, grinding them by hand with something like a mortar and pestle situation, and brewing it all in a traditional pot. Very honestly, the smell alone is great!
The taste? Is that like…well, that depends! Usually, it’s very is strong, and rich, with a hint of smokiness because they roasted those beans on an open fire. Mnemba Atoll Snorkeling: Underwater Paradise, is that correct?
Right, so onto the bit most people are there for: snorkeling at Mnemba Atoll. As snorkeling spots around Zanzibar go, they’re some of the best you’re going to find, very are they, in fact! So, really is this a little circular reef island, off the northeast coast, totally bursting with ocean wildlife of all shapes and sizes. What happens typically is you grab your snorkeling stuff and you hop onto a boat before it heads on over.
And that’s where you find totally clear water with so many shades of blue and green, and you start to see coral gardens and brightly colored fish, do you see it? In the right weather conditions you should have decent visibility of all these super beautiful things. You might even get to see turtles or dolphins. Potential Downsides and Things to Bear in Mind
It’s so true, while it does sound very, very cool, a crammed itinerary could well mean that you’re spending the entire day rushed off your feet, you know? Each of the locations ends up getting less of your time and attention.
Also, Mnemba Atoll has the very great possibility of getting crowded, particularly in high season. Now, combine that fact with lots of tours turning up at the same time and suddenly you aren’t getting that totally tranquil ocean experience you’re kind of imagining, very is it?
It’s also important to very, very think about how much travel is involved. A lot of Zanzibar’s roads may not always be fantastic. Could be that zipping from a coffee place to the farms and gardens and on to Mnemba could just mean very, very spending large chunks of your day crammed in some kind of mini-van type arrangement.
